Frequently Asked Questions
It is a moderate-level trek, but prior trekking experience and good physical fitness are strongly recommended due to high altitude and long daily walking hours.
Upper Mustang is a restricted trekking zone requiring a special government permit (USD 500) — this is fully included in the package price.
Spring (March–May) and Autumn (September–November) are ideal; Upper Mustang is also one of the rare treks accessible in monsoon season (June–August) due to its rain-shadow location
Yes — both legs of the domestic flight (Pokhara–Jomsom and Jomsom–Pokhara) are fully included in the package, though flights are subject to weather conditions.
Accommodation includes 3-star hotels in Kathmandu and Pokhara, and basic but comfortable local tea houses and lodges throughout the trekking route on a twin-sharing basis
